Personal Survival
Personal Survival 1
By completing this Award you will be able to, in clothing and in the order listed without pause:
- Enter water of at least full reach depth* from the side of the pool by sliding in from a sitting position.
- Tread water for two minutes.
- Swim 25 metres to a floating object.
- Take up and hold the ‘H.E.L.P.’ position for five minutes in water of at least full reach depth.*
- Swim 50 metres retaining the floating object.
- Climb out from water of at least full reach depth* without using the steps or rail or any other assistance.
- Answer three questions on when the skills learned might be used.
* Full reach depth is the distance from feet to finger tips of hands reaching above the head.
Personal Survival 2
By completing this Award you will be able to, in clothing and in the order listed without pause:
- Enter water of at least full reach depth* using a straddle entry.
- Tread water for two minutes with one arm out of the water (the raised hand to be above the head throughout, swimmers may
change arms twice throughout). - Swim 25 metres to a floating object.
- Take up and hold the ‘H.E.L.P.’ position for six minutes.
- Participate in a ‘HUDDLE’ for two minutes using any floating object for support with at least two other similarly clothed
swimmers. - Swim 100 metres retaining a floating object.
- Climb out from water of at least full reach depth* without using the steps or rail.
- Answer three questions on when the skills learned might be used.
* Full reach depth is the distance from feet to finger tips of hands reaching above the head.
